Recently, twitter user Shameera Idlyn went to a Chinese store with her boyfriend to buy some food, reports Mothership.

The food they were buying contained pork and with them being Malay, there were a few judgmental stares directed towards them, according to Shameera.

But the thing is they weren’t buying the food for themselves! No, they were tapau-ing the food for an elderly Chinese uncle who seems to be known among their circles, looking at the Twitter replies.

Most people were very touched by the gesture and praised the couple for their kind act. Their video also proved that we should never judge a book by it’s cover.

But there were a few that lamented the fact that they even bought food with pork and said “buy halal food for the man also can wat..”
